Ready to gain practical project management experience by contributing to technology programmes with national significance?

As an Industrial Placement Project Manager within our Cyber & Intelligence business, you will support the delivery of challenging technology projects for customers with complex and sensitive data requirements. Your work will contribute to digital transformation programmes that use modern software engineering practices to deliver meaningful outcomes.

Working directly with experienced project managers, you will become a key member of the project team and gain insight into the processes, tools and professional relationships that support successful delivery. From scheduling and cost management to project governance and stakeholder communications, you will build practical experience while contributing to real project assignments.

This is an opportunity to apply your academic learning, develop valuable project management skills and contribute to real-world challenges in defence and technology.

Our Industrial Placement Programme

Our structured 12-month Industrial Placement Programme is designed to help you develop the practical skills needed to build a successful career in defence and technology.

Starting in September 2027, the programme will give you the opportunity to contribute to project management support assignments and take part in an Industrial Placement group project. You will have a dedicated mentor, buddy, project lead and line manager, providing guidance and support throughout your placement.

From the beginning, you will contribute to meaningful work while learning from experienced project managers and building your professional network across Northrop Grumman UK.

What you’ll do

  • Support project scheduling, cost budgeting and estimating
  • Help coordinate resources while learning to use project management tools
  • Maintain accurate project documentation and governance materials
  • Assist with identifying, recording and monitoring project risks
  • Track project key performance indicators and associated metrics
  • Support timely project reporting in line with established business rhythms
  • Help organise stakeholder communications to ensure project information is shared effectively

Along the way, you could develop experience in:

  • Project scheduling and resource coordination
  • Cost budgeting and estimating
  • Project management tools and processes
  • Project documentation and governance
  • Risk and performance management
  • Stakeholder communication
  • Project reporting and metrics

What we’re looking for

We are looking for students who are curious about how successful projects are delivered, enjoy solving problems and want to develop practical experience within a collaborative environment. You will bring a genuine interest in project management, an analytical approach and a willingness to learn from the people around you.

Essential:

  • Currently working towards a relevant degree (or can demonstrate equivalent knowledge and skills through work experience or other training)
  • A genuine interest in project management
  • Strong analytical skills and logical reasoning
  • An understanding of the project lifecycle and the importance of delivering to deadlines
  • The ability to approach problems and develop innovative solutions
  • Knowledge and understanding of business and financial concepts, tools and processes
